Frequently Asked Questions

What is the CareGrader rating for 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E?

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E in RIVERSIDE, California has a CareGrader grade of B (Good), with a composite score of 82.3 out of 100. This grade is based on health inspections, staffing levels, quality measures, and penalty history from official CMS government data.

What is the CMS star rating for 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E?

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E has an overall CMS star rating of 4 out of 5, a health inspection rating of 4/5, and a staffing rating of 2/5. CareGrader combines this with additional data to calculate an A-F grade.

How many health deficiencies does 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E have?

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E has 44 health deficiencies on record from CMS health inspection surveys. Deficiencies are rated from A (minimal harm potential) to L (immediate jeopardy, widespread). View the full inspection timeline above for details on each deficiency.

How many beds does 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E have?

ALTA VISTA HEALTHCARE & WELLNESS CENTRE has 99 certified beds with approximately 91 current residents (92% occupancy). The facility is located at 9020 GARFIELD STREET, RIVERSIDE, California 92503. It is a for profit - limited liability company facility.

Data Disclaimer

Inspection data, staffing levels, and star ratings are sourced from CMS Medicare Nursing Home Compare and are largely self-reported by facilities. A 2019 GAO study found that 43% of facilities under-reported falls. CareGrader provides this data for informational purposes only and is not affiliated with CMS or Medicare. Always visit facilities in person before making a decision.
